Bing Emoji Search

Microsoft today announced that they are adding support for Emoji characters in Bing search in all English markets. People nowadays use emojis more often for expressing themselves in an efficient way. This new Bing update lets them use the same language to search the web.

With this new feature, you can search using your favorite emoji, and Bing will return results based on the semantic meaning of the emoji. But emoji search on Bing can be even more powerful than just finding out an emoji’s meaning.  You can combine them to create more multi-word searches. See the above image for example.
